Berkeley Springs High School Chess team takes state title, earns way to national competition

Berkeley Springs High School’s chess team triumphed at the 55th West Virginia State Scholastic Chess Championship in Clarksburg. Winning first place from among six teams and 31 players, the Berkeley Springs team earned their way to nationals – a first for the school’s chess program.

Team members traveled to the 2026 National High School Championship in Chicago, Illinois this past weekend, earning 27th place in a field of 52 teams.

Berkeley Springs High School Chess team members: Dylan Stewart, Malcolm Johns, Rylee David Sauters, Brian Ailor, Joseph Guzman-Robles, Brody Gloyd, Adam O’Brien and Moises Guzman-Robles.
